Embracing Compassion: 5 Techniques for Self-Care
In the tapestry of life, moments of hardship are inevitable. It's during these times that the power of self-compassion shines brightest. Cultivating a gentle heart towards ourselves is not about ignoring our setbacks, but rather accepting them with warmth. This practice allows us to heal from adversity and approach life with a renewed sense of resilience. Here are 5 methods to ignite self-compassion within your heart.
- Identify Your Struggles: The first step towards self-compassion is acknowledging our own hurt. Don't belittle your emotions. Allow yourself to feel them fully.
- Be Gentle with Your Inner Voice: Treat yourself with the same compassion that you would offer a dear friend going through a difficult time. Replace criticism with affirmation.
- Engage in Present Moment Awareness: Turn your attention to the present moment, observing your thoughts without judgment. This helps anchor you and ease stress.
- Nurture Yourself: Make time for activities that offer you pleasure. This could include anything from reading to laughing with loved ones.
- Seek Support When Needed: Remember, you are not alone. Don't shy away from connecting with therapists when you need it most.
